# Room & Rates

> What you are selling through RecepAI, who fits in it, and at what price.

**Room & Rates** is the foundation. Nothing else in this group works until it is filled in: the calendar has nothing to price, and strategies have nothing to adjust.

A switch at the top turns Guerrilla Reservation on for your hotel.

## What is on the screen

Three tabs.

### Room Setup

What you are offering and who fits in it:

* **Guest-Facing Name** — what the guest sees. It is the name of the offer, not a room type from your PMS.
* **Description**
* **Max Adults**, **Max Children**, **Max Total Guests**
* **Charge teens as adults**, and how you name a younger age group
* **Minimum price** — the floor below which the offer is not sold

### Pricing

Where you set what it costs by how many people are staying. The screen states the pricing arrangement your hotel is set up on, and the number of guests that arrangement treats as the base.

Two kinds of entry live here: **price rules that apply to all dates**, and **seasonal overrides** for the stretches that are different.

### Rate Plans

Up to a handful of plans, each one a different deal on the same room:

| Field                                           |                            |
| ----------------------------------------------- | -------------------------- |
| **Name**                                        | What it is called          |
| **Meal Plan**                                   | What is included           |
| **Min Stay**, **Max Stay**                      | Nights, or no limit        |
| **Policy Type**, **Free cancel before (hours)** | Your cancellation terms    |
| **Card policy**                                 | Whether a card is required |
| **Currency**, **Active**                        |                            |

Each plan also carries **Child Pricing**, set per age group you defined in Room Setup. Each group is *Free*, a *Fixed amount / night*, or a *% of nightly base price* — and choosing the fixed amount is what reveals the **Lodging / night** and **Meal / night** boxes, so board costs for a child can be priced separately from the bed. **First child free** sits alongside.

## What you do here

<Steps>
  <Step title="Set the room up before anything else">
    Occupancy limits decide which quotes are even possible. A party that does not fit is never offered a price.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Name it as a guest would read it">
    This name appears in the conversation. "Surprise Room" is an offer; "DBL-STD-2" is an internal code.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Set the minimum price deliberately">
    It is the floor. A quote that would fall below it is not sold at all rather than sold cheaply — so set it to a number you would genuinely accept.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Build your rate plans last">
    Each plan is a different promise to the guest — what is included, how long they must stay, how late they can cancel. Write the promise you will keep.
  </Step>
</Steps>

<Warning>
  **Every field here is a promise made in a conversation.** Free cancellation hours and meal inclusion are quoted to guests and honoured against what is set here. Change them knowing that bookings already taken carry the terms they were sold under.
</Warning>

## What happens next

Setting this screen up is the first step, not the last. Before your AI staff can quote a date, four things have to be true together:

1. Guerrilla Reservation is switched on,
2. the room is set up,
3. at least one rate plan is **active**,
4. and that date has **both a price and inventory you can still sell** on [Calendar](/front-desk/guerrilla/calendar).

A date missing any of them is not quoted. [Strategies](/front-desk/guerrilla/strategies) then adjust from the calendar price.
